What are the different types of Selective Invoice Finance for Medical Device Suppliers?
Spot Factoring
Finance for individual invoices, chosen by the supplier, instead of all invoices.
Selective Invoice Discounting
Supplier gets funding on selected invoices but keeps the collections process in-house.
Single Invoice Finance
Short-term finance based on a single invoice, often used for large or urgent orders.

What is Selective Invoice Finance?
Selective Invoice Finance (SIF) allows medical device suppliers to choose individual invoices to sell to a finance provider in exchange for immediate cash, instead of financing their entire sales ledger. This provides quick funds to cover expenses or grow the business.
Advantages for Medical Device Suppliers
SIF offers flexibility because suppliers decide which invoices to finance and when to use the service. There are no long-term contracts required, and suppliers can maintain control over their accounts receivable process.

The main benefits include improved cash flow, reduced financial pressure, and operational support. Suppliers can access most of their invoice value quickly (usually 70-96%), avoid taking on debt, and focus resources on growth or large orders. However, each invoice must be approved, and there may be higher fees per transaction compared to whole-ledger finance.
